Alabama Ranked No. 3 In First Coaches Poll
The first Amway Coaches Poll of the college football season has been released. The Alabama Crimson Tide was ranked third in the inaugural poll and received zero first place votes. Clemson and Ohio State were ranked first and second respectively.

Alabama Ranked No. 1 in 2016 Preseason Coaches Poll
For just the third time in the past 25 years, the Alabama Crimson Tide will open the season as the No. 1 team in the Amway Coaches Poll. The first preseason college football poll of 2016 was released on Thursday morning and Nick Saban's team will pick up where it left off in January...

Alabama Back to #1 in the Coaches Poll
Without playing a game in week 5, the Alabama Crimson Tide moved up to #1 in the Amway Coaches Poll. Florida State lost the top spot after holding on to win 56-41 against NC State in a game where the Seminoles trailed by as many as 17 points at one time...
